(inklusive 30 Tage KOSTENLOSE Testversion)
(nur $59.90)
XML (Extensible Markup Language) ist ein textbasiertes Format für strukturierte Daten. Es verwendet verschachtelte Tags zur Beschreibung von Datensätzen, Feldern und Hierarchien. XML ist das Standard-Austauschformat für SOAP-Webdienste, Unternehmenssysteme (SAP, Oracle), Daten-Feeds, Konfigurationsdateien und Behördenmeldungen. Jede Programmiersprache kann XML parsen, aber Datenbanken können es nicht direkt ausführen.
SQL (Structured Query Language) ist die Standardsprache für relationale Datenbanken. Eine SQL-Datei enthält ausführbare Anweisungen — CREATE TABLE, INSERT INTO, UPDATE, DELETE — die eine Datenbank-Engine ausführt, um Tabellen zu erstellen und zu füllen. Bei der Konvertierung von XML in SQL wird jedes Datensatz-Element zu einer INSERT-Anweisung und jedes Kindelement einem Tabellenfeld zugeordnet. Die resultierende .sql-Datei kann in MySQL, PostgreSQL, SQL Server, SQLite, MariaDB oder jedem anderen SQL-kompatiblen System ausgeführt werden.
| XML | SQL | |
|---|---|---|
| Zweck | Strukturierter Datenaustausch | Maschinenausführbare Datenbankbefehle |
| Geöffnet mit | Beliebiger Texteditor, XML-Parser, Browser | MySQL, PostgreSQL, SQLite, SQL Server |
| Struktur | Verschachtelte Tags mit Elementen und Attributen | INSERT-Anweisungen mit Feld-Wert-Paaren |
| Verwendung | APIs, Webdienste, ERP, Daten-Feeds | Datenbankimport, Migration, Seeding |
| Datentypen | Alles ist Text (schemaabhängig) | Explizit (VARCHAR, INT, DATE usw.) |
| Automatisierung | Erfordert eine XML-Parser-Bibliothek | Läuft direkt in jedem Datenbank-Client |
Die Konvertierung von XML in SQL schließt die Lücke zwischen Datenaustausch und Datenbankspeicherung. Anstatt für jeden XML-Feed eigene Parser zu schreiben, erhalten Sie eine ausführbare .sql-Datei.
Jede XML-Datei erzeugt eine separate .sql-Datei mit INSERT-Anweisungen. XML-Elementnamen werden zu Feldnamen, und jedes Datensatz-Element wird zu einem INSERT. Die Ausgabe ist sofort in jedem SQL-Client ausführbar.
Total XML Converter enthält eine Kommandozeilenschnittstelle für die Automatisierung:
XMLConverter.exe C:\Data\*.xml C:\Output\ -c SQL
Dieser Befehl konvertiert jede XML-Datei im Quellordner in SQL. Betten Sie den Befehl in eine .bat-Datei ein oder planen Sie ihn mit dem Windows-Aufgabenplaner für automatische nächtliche Konvertierungen — ideal für ETL-Pipelines, die XML-Daten in relationale Datenbanken einspeisen.
Der Konverter erzeugt .sql-Dateien mit korrekten INSERT-Anweisungen. XML-Elementnamen werden auf Feldnamen abgebildet, Werte werden korrekt für die SQL-Syntax in Anführungszeichen gesetzt und maskiert. Kein manuelles Nacharbeiten — leiten Sie die Datei in Ihren Datenbank-Client und die Daten landen in der Tabelle.
Wählen Sie einen Ordner mit 10 oder 10.000 XML-Dateien, klicken Sie auf Start und lehnen Sie sich zurück. Total XML Converter verarbeitet den gesamten Stapel ohne Interaktion. Für wiederkehrende Aufgaben nutzen Sie die Kommandozeile mit einem geplanten Skript.
Verschachtelte Elemente, Attribute, Namespaces, CDATA-Abschnitte — der Konverter verarbeitet sie alle. Tief verschachtelte XML-Feeds von SOAP-Diensten oder behördlichen Datenportalen werden in saubere INSERT-Anweisungen umgewandelt.
Total XML Converter verwendet eine eigene XML-Parsing-Engine. Sie benötigen keine XML-Bibliotheken, Datenbanktools oder Skriptsprachen auf dem Rechner. Das vereinfacht Server-Deployments und reduziert Abhängigkeiten.
Die gesamte Konvertierung läuft lokal auf Ihrem Windows-PC. Finanzdaten, Kundendaten und Gesundheitsdaten bleiben auf Ihrem Rechner. Es wird nichts in einen Cloud-Dienst hochgeladen.
Neben SQL schreibt Total XML Converter JSON, CSV, XLSX, PDF, HTML, DOC, TXT und mehr. Eine Lizenz deckt alle Formatkombinationen ab.
| Funktion | Online-Tools | Total XML Converter |
|---|---|---|
| Stapelkonvertierung | Eine Datei auf einmal | Unbegrenzte Dateien pro Stapel |
| Datenschutz | Dateien werden auf Server Dritter hochgeladen | 100 % offline |
| Dateigrößenlimit | 5–50 MB | Kein Limit |
| SQL-Syntax | Generisch, oft fehlerhaft | Korrekt maskierte INSERT-Anweisungen |
| Komplexes XML | Namespaces werden oft entfernt | Volle Unterstützung für verschachtelte Strukturen |
| Kommandozeile | Nicht verfügbar | Vollständige CLI für Automatisierung |
| Geschwindigkeit | Abhängig von Upload/Download | Sofort (lokale Verarbeitung) |
| Preis | Kostenlose Stufe mit Einschränkungen, dann Abonnement | Einmalig $59.90 |
(inklusive 30 Tage KOSTENLOSE Testversion)
(nur $59.90)
"Wir erhalten jede Nacht Bestands-Feeds von Lieferanten als XML. Unser PostgreSQL-Warehouse benötigt SQL. Total XML Converter läuft in einer geplanten .bat-Datei um 3 Uhr morgens und konvertiert alles. Um 4 Uhr übernimmt der Import-Job die SQL-Dateien. Seit sechs Monaten kein manueller Aufwand."
Henrik Lindberg Database Administrator
"Unser ERP exportiert Transaktionsprotokolle als XML. Ich konvertiere sie stapelweise in SQL und lade sie in unsere Berichtsdatenbank. Der Konverter verarbeitet verschachtelte XML-Elemente sauber, und die INSERT-Anweisungen laufen ohne Syntaxfehler in MySQL. Das erspart mir das Schreiben von XSLT für jeden Feed."
Nadia Petrova Integration Engineer
"Gutes Tool, um XML-Daten in SQL Server zu importieren. Der Stapelmodus verarbeitet unsere täglich über 200 XML-Dateien problemlos. Die Kommandozeile fügt sich in unsere bestehenden ETL-Skripte ein. Eine Option zur Generierung von CREATE-TABLE-Anweisungen zusammen mit den INSERTs wäre wünschenswert."
David Chen Data Analyst
XMLConverter.exe C:\Data\*.xml C:\Output\ -c SQL aus, um einen ganzen Ordner zu konvertieren. Planen Sie den Befehl in einer .bat-Datei für die automatische nächtliche Verarbeitung.Laden Sie die Testversion herunter und konvertieren Sie Ihre Dateien in wenigen Minuten.
Keine Kreditkarte oder Email erforderlich.

Verwandte Themen
Total XML Converter Video-Tutorial